package org.apache.openjpa.lib.graph;
import java.util.Collection;
import java.util.Iterator;
import org.apache.openjpa.lib.test.AbstractTestCase;
/**
* <p>Tests the {@link Graph} type, and in so doing implicitly tests the
* {@link Edge} as well.</p>
*
* @author Abe White
*/
public class TestGraph
extends AbstractTestCase {
private Graph _graph = new Graph();
private Object _node1 = new Object();
private Object _node2 = new Object();
private Object _node3 = new Object();
private Edge _edge1 = new Edge(_node1, _node2, true);
private Edge _edge2 = new Edge(_node2, _node3, true);
private Edge _edge3 = new Edge(_node1, _node3, false);
private Edge _edge4 = new Edge(_node2, _node2, false);
public void setUp() {
_graph.addNode(_node1);
_graph.addNode(_node2);
_graph.addNode(_node3);
_graph.addEdge(_edge1);
_graph.addEdge(_edge2);
_graph.addEdge(_edge3);
_graph.addEdge(_edge4);
}
/**
* Tests adding and retrieving nodes and edges.
*/
public void testAddRetrieve() {
assertEquals(3, _graph.getNodes().size());
assertEquals(4, _graph.getEdges().size());
Collection edges = _graph.getEdgesFrom(_node1);
assertEquals(2, edges.size());
Iterator itr = edges.iterator();
Edge edge0 = (Edge) itr.next();
Edge edge1 = (Edge) itr.next();
assertTrue((edge0 == _edge1 && edge1 == _edge3)
|| (edge0 == _edge3 && edge1 == _edge1));
edges = _graph.getEdgesTo(_node1);
assertEquals(1, edges.size());
assertEquals(_edge3, edges.iterator().next());
edges = _graph.getEdges(_node1, _node3);
assertEquals(1, edges.size());
assertEquals(_edge3, edges.iterator().next());
edges = _graph.getEdges(_node3, _node1);
assertEquals(1, edges.size());
assertEquals(_edge3, edges.iterator().next());
edges = _graph.getEdgesFrom(_node2);
assertEquals(2, edges.size());
itr = edges.iterator();
edge0 = (Edge) itr.next();
edge1 = (Edge) itr.next();
assertTrue((edge0 == _edge2 && edge1 == _edge4)
|| (edge0 == _edge4 && edge1 == _edge2));
edges = _graph.getEdgesTo(_node2);
assertEquals(2, edges.size());
itr = edges.iterator();
edge0 = (Edge) itr.next();
edge1 = (Edge) itr.next();
assertTrue((edge0 == _edge1 && edge1 == _edge4)
|| (edge0 == _edge4 && edge1 == _edge1));
edges = _graph.getEdges(_node2, _node2);
assertEquals(1, edges.size());
assertEquals(_edge4, edges.iterator().next());
edges = _graph.getEdgesFrom(_node3);
assertEquals(1, edges.size());
assertEquals(_edge3, edges.iterator().next());
}
/**
* Test removing edges.
*/
public void testRemoveEdges() {
assertTrue(_graph.removeEdge(_edge2));
Collection edges = _graph.getEdgesFrom(_node2);
assertEquals(1, edges.size());
assertEquals(_edge4, edges.iterator().next());
assertTrue(_graph.removeEdge(_edge3));
edges = _graph.getEdgesFrom(_node1);
assertEquals(1, edges.size());
assertEquals(_edge1, edges.iterator().next());
edges = _graph.getEdgesTo(_node1);
assertEquals(0, edges.size());
edges = _graph.getEdgesTo(_node3);
assertEquals(0, edges.size());
edges = _graph.getEdgesFrom(_node3);
assertEquals(0, edges.size());
}
/**
* Test removing nodes.
*/
public void testRemoveNodes() {
assertTrue(_graph.removeNode(_node3));
Collection edges = _graph.getEdges();
assertEquals(2, edges.size());
Iterator itr = edges.iterator();
Edge edge0 = (Edge) itr.next();
Edge edge1 = (Edge) itr.next();
assertTrue((edge0 == _edge1 && edge1 == _edge4)
|| (edge0 == _edge4 && edge1 == _edge1));
edges = _graph.getEdgesFrom(_node1);
assertEquals(1, edges.size());
assertEquals(_edge1, edges.iterator().next());
edges = _graph.getEdgesTo(_node1);
assertEquals(0, edges.size());
}
public static void main(String[] args) {
main(TestGraph.class);
}
}
